Building record 0035405000 - STATUE OF JOHN HAMPDEN
Summary
Early twentieth century statue of John Hampden, in Market Square
Protected Status/Designation
- Listed Building (II) 1365631: STATUE OF JOHN HAMPDEN
Map
Type and Period (1)
- STATUE (Constructed 1911, 20th Century to Modern - 1900 AD to 1945 AD)
Description
Grade II. 1911 by Henry C Fehr. Bronze on stone pedestal (B11).
Monument to John Hampden by H C Fehr, 1911-12; naturalistic and conventionally theatrical (B10).
